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Reporting to the Senior Associate AD for Strategic Communications with shared oversight by Football Recruiting Staff, the Director of Football Creative Media will be responsible for the graphic design, photography and producing and editing of highly creative videos that highlight the App State football program and its student-athletes, engage recruits and fans, and tell the story of App State Football to a variety of audiences.
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: Support App State Football efforts to build brand affinity for Mountaineer Football, to increase and enhance the strategic initiatives established by the external units.
Create high-level graphics and oversee student graphic designers in the creation of motion and still graphics for use on social platforms, recruiting, and other areas.
Oversee photography for recruit shoots, workouts, practices, home and away games, etc.
Shoot, produce, and edit highly creative videos for the App State football program, at the direction of the Football Recruiting Staff, Associate AD for Football Operations, Senior Associate AD for Strategic Communications, football coaches, and staff.
Create videos that highlight App State football's tradition, culture, setting, fans, facilities, student-athletes, uniforms, game day atmosphere, etc.
Create graphics, photos, and videos for publication on at least the following platforms: Instagram, Facebook, X, and YouTube.
Assist with creative needs for on-campus recruiting events, producing high-level content in a timely fashion.
Maintain a creative calendar to assist with production timelines and scheduling.
Member of the App State Football Content Team that strategizes and executes creative content for the program.
Work closely with the Marketing, Strategic Communications, Sports Productions, and associated external units on creative concepts and strategies.
Adhere to guidance from the Senior Associate AD for Strategic Communications, Director of Sports Productions, and Director of Creative Services on appropriate use and enhancement of the App State visual brand.
Other duties as assigned
